まとめ
研究者は,M ((II) /Al ((III) クラスタを組み込んだ新しい異金属アルミニウムベースの金属有機フレームワーク (Al-MOF) を合成した. これらの新しいMOFは,二酸化炭素と炭化水素の例外的なガス吸収と選択的分離能力を示しています.

背景:
- 自然界は,スピネルや二重酸化物などの材料でM (II) やAl (III) のような電荷補充金属イオンを使用しています.
- ヘテロメタリック結合,特にMg-Alは,金属有機フレームワーク (MOF) で顕著に欠けています.
研究 の 目的:
- M (II) / Al (III) トリメアクラスタを含む新しい異金属Al-MOFの合成を報告する.
- 新しく合成されたMOFのガス吸附と分離特性を調査する.
主な方法:
- M (II) 塩化物とアルミニウム乳酸を用いたM (II) とAl (III) の協同結晶化.
- 分離されたACSトポロジーを持つ毛穴空間分割MOFの合成.
- 298Kと1バーでのガス吸収と選択性測定
- ガス混合物の分離に関する突破的な実験.
主要な成果:
- M (II) / Al (III) トリメアクラスター (M = Mg, Mn, Co, Ni) を有する異金属Al-MOFを合成した.
- 急速な結晶運動 (約. 3時間) と調整可能な多孔性.
- 高濃度のガス吸収量:CO2の場合112 cm3/g,C2H2の場合176 cm3/g,C2H4の場合156 cm3/g,C2H6の場合163 cm3/g
- C2H2/CO2 (8.5まで) とC2H2/C2H4 (10.8まで) に対して高い選択性を示した.
結論:
- M ((II) クロリドとアルミニウム乳酸の相乗効果は,効率的な協同結晶化を可能にします.
- 合成された異金属Al-MOFは,ガス貯蔵と選択的なガス分離で有望な応用を提供します.
- これらのMOFは,炭素捕獲と炭化水素分離の課題に取り組むための新しい材料のクラスです.

Properties of Organometallic Compounds
848
Organometallic compounds are compounds that contain a carbon–metal bond. Carbon belongs to an organyl group like alkyl, aryl, allyl, or benzyl groups. The metal can be from Group I or Group II of the periodic table, a transition metal, or a semimetal.

Metallic Solids
18.0K
Metallic solids such as crystals of copper, aluminum, and iron are formed by metal atoms. The structure of metallic crystals is often described as a uniform distribution of atomic nuclei within a “sea” of delocalized electrons. The atoms within such a metallic solid are held together by a unique force known as metallic bonding that gives rise to many useful and varied bulk properties.

Acid Halides to Alcohols: LiAlH4 Reduction
2.6K
Acid halides are reduced to alcohols in the presence of a strong reducing agent like lithium aluminum hydride.
The mechanism proceeds in three steps. First, the nucleophilic hydride ion attacks the carbonyl carbon of the acid halide to form a tetrahedral intermediate. Next, the carbonyl group is re-formed, and the halide ion departs as a leaving group, generating an aldehyde.
